Paver Walkway Installation in Fairfield County, CT

Paver walkway installation involves creating durable, attractive pathways using interlocking pavers made from materials such as concrete, brick, or natural stone. These walkways can enhance the curb appeal of residential properties, providing a defined and functional route from the driveway or yard to entrances or garden areas. Projects typically include designing and laying out walkways that complement the landscape, ensuring proper base preparation for stability, and selecting paver styles and patterns that match the property's aesthetic. Homeowners often want to understand the different paver options available, the installation process, and how the finished walkway will withstand foot traffic and weather conditions.

Property owners interested in paver walkway installation should consider factors like the size and shape of the space, drainage requirements, and the overall style of their home. It's important to clarify the intended use of the walkway, whether for daily foot traffic, decorative purposes, or both, and to discuss maintenance needs to ensure long-lasting results. Additionally, understanding the scope of the project-including site preparation, material choices, and any necessary permits-can help homeowners plan effectively for a successful installation that enhances both function and appearance.

FAQ

Paver Walkway Installation Questions

What types of pavers are suitable for walkways? Common options include concrete, brick, and natural stone, each offering different aesthetic and durability benefits for walkways.

How deep should a paver walkway be installed? Typically, pavers are installed on a base that is at least 4 to 6 inches deep to ensure stability and proper drainage.

Can paver walkways be installed over existing surfaces? Yes, pavers can often be installed over existing concrete or compacted gravel, provided the surface is stable and level.

What maintenance is required for paver walkways? Regular cleaning and occasional re-sanding between pavers help maintain appearance and prevent weed growth.
